引言
在大数据时代,数据已经成为企业的重要资产。阿里巴巴作为中国乃至全球最大的电商平台之一,在大数据建模和预测领域积累了丰富的经验。本文将揭秘阿里大数据建模的核心技术和方法,探讨如何打造精准预测的智慧引擎。
一、大数据建模概述
1.1 大数据建模的定义
大数据建模是指利用统计学、机器学习等方法,从海量数据中提取有价值的信息,建立预测模型,为决策提供支持的过程。
1.2 大数据建模的意义
大数据建模可以帮助企业:
- 提高业务决策的准确性;
- 发现市场趋势;
- 优化资源配置;
- 提升客户满意度。
二、阿里大数据建模的核心技术
2.1 数据采集与处理
阿里大数据建模的第一步是采集和处理数据。阿里云提供了强大的数据采集和处理能力,包括:
- 数据采集:通过阿里云日志服务、数据集成服务等工具,实现海量数据的采集;
- 数据处理:通过阿里云数据开发、数据仓库等产品,对数据进行清洗、转换、集成等操作。
2.2 特征工程
特征工程是大数据建模的关键环节,它通过对原始数据进行处理,提取出对预测任务有用的特征。阿里大数据建模中常用的特征工程方法包括:
- 数据归一化:将不同量纲的数据转换为相同的量纲;
- 特征选择:选择对预测任务最有影响力的特征;
- 特征构造:通过组合原始特征,构造新的特征。
2.3 模型选择与训练
阿里大数据建模中常用的模型包括:
- 线性回归:用于预测连续变量;
- 逻辑回归:用于预测二元分类问题;
- 决策树:用于预测分类或回归问题;
- 集成学习:通过组合多个弱学习器,提高预测精度。
模型训练过程中,阿里云提供了丰富的机器学习算法和工具,如阿里云机器学习平台、MaxCompute等。
2.4 模型评估与优化
模型评估是确保模型预测准确性的重要环节。阿里大数据建模中常用的评估指标包括:
- 准确率:预测正确的样本占所有样本的比例;
- 召回率:预测为正样本的样本中,实际为正样本的比例;
- F1值:准确率和召回率的调和平均值。
模型优化可以通过调整模型参数、选择更合适的模型或进行特征工程等方法实现。
三、打造精准预测的智慧引擎
3.1 数据质量
数据质量是大数据建模的基础。阿里大数据建模过程中,对数据质量的要求非常高,包括:
- 数据的完整性:确保数据中没有缺失值;
- 数据的准确性:确保数据真实可靠;
- 数据的时效性:确保数据是最新的。
3.2 模型迭代
大数据建模是一个不断迭代的过程。阿里大数据建模团队会根据实际业务需求,不断优化模型,提高预测精度。
3.3 智能化
阿里大数据建模致力于打造智能化预测引擎,通过引入人工智能技术,实现模型的自动调优、预测结果的可解释性等。
四、案例分析
以下是一个阿里大数据建模的实际案例:
4.1 案例背景
某电商平台希望通过大数据建模,预测用户购买商品的意愿,从而提高用户购买转化率。
4.2 案例方法
- 数据采集:通过电商平台的数据采集工具,收集用户行为数据、商品信息等;
- 特征工程:对原始数据进行清洗、转换、构造等操作,提取用户特征、商品特征等;
- 模型选择与训练:选择逻辑回归模型,使用MaxCompute进行模型训练;
- 模型评估与优化:使用准确率、召回率等指标评估模型性能,根据评估结果调整模型参数或选择更合适的模型。
4.3 案例结果
通过大数据建模,该电商平台成功预测了用户购买商品的意愿,提高了用户购买转化率。
五、总结
阿里大数据建模在预测领域取得了显著的成果,为企业的决策提供了有力支持。通过本文的介绍,相信大家对阿里大数据建模有了更深入的了解。在大数据时代,掌握大数据建模技术,将为企业和个人带来更多机遇。
